Time Out says

Prendergast was an American Postimpressionist noted especially for his mastery of watercolor. Like his contemporaries in France, he painted modern life as Baudelaire once advised artists to do, only Prendergast didn’t just “paint” his scenes of people frolicking at the beach or strolling through the park: He dissolved them in a solvent of liquid color, puddled into pointillist daubs. The show rounds up his series of languid aquarelles depicting the leisurely goings-on at the Public Garden in his hometown, Boston.
